Dan Haren's outing ended after he was hit by a line drive on the final out of the eighth inning, Peter Bourjos and Vernon Wells homered, and the Los Angeles Angels beat the Toronto Blue Jays 7-1 on Wednesday night.
Haren (16-9) was struck on the inside of the left wrist, his non-throwing arm, by Eric Thames' liner. The ball caromed to Maicer Izturis at second base, who threw to first for the third out as Haren fell to the ground in pain. He was able to walk off but headed straight down the tunnel to the clubhouse.
Haren allowed one run and four hits over eight innings for his first road victory since winning at Detroit on July 30. The right-hander, who walked two and struck out four, had gone 0-3 in five road starts since then.
